What are the birds that run along the beach?

Sandpipers are familiar birds that are often seen running near the water’s edge on beaches and tidal mud flats.

What are the black and white birds at the beach?

Oystercatchers are the cute, tiny, black-and-white birds with bright orange beaks. There are various types of oystercatchers, but the American Oystercatchers can be found on U.S. beaches, Cuba, Brazil, and Mexico. On the Atlantic Coast, you can find oystercatchers spanning from Florida to Massachusetts.

What is the most common near shore bird?

The Sanderling is one of the most widespread of all shorebirds. It is most commonly found in huge numbers on the east coast in Delaware Bay feeding with knots and turnstones.

What is a sandpiper bird look like?

The Spotted Sandpiper is a medium-sized shorebird with a bill slightly shorter than its head and a body that tapers to a longish tail. They have a rounded breast and usually appear as though they are leaning forward.

What is the difference between a killdeer and a plover?

Killdeer are noticeably larger than Piping Plovers and have about twice as much mass. However, it is the Piping Plover that often pushes around the Killdeer as evidenced by the photo series, below. A Piping Plover (right) approaching a Killdeer that is unwelcome on the Piping Plover’s turf.

What is the difference between a sandpiper and a plover?

Breeding adult Piping Plovers are plumper and paler, with shorter bills than Least Sandpipers. Piping Plovers tend to occur higher up on the beach than Least Sandpipers.

How do you identify a sandpiper?

They have brown upperparts and white underparts. Their bills are black, and their legs are yellowish-green (this can be obscured by mud at times). Juveniles have crisp plumage that is rustier than that of adults. In flight, Least Sandpipers show whitish rumps bisected by a longitudinal black line.

What are the tiny birds at the beach called?

These small sandpipers are called Sanderlings. Rachel Carson, whose book Under the Sea Wind set a high standard for nature writing, described Sanderlings as running “with a twinkle of black feet.” Carson depicted Sanderlings’ foraging along the beach as “keeping in the thin film at the edge of the ebbing surf . . .

What bird is grey with a black head?

Catbirds give the impression of being entirely slaty gray. With a closer look you’ll see a small black cap, blackish tail, and a rich rufous-brown patch under the tail. Catbirds are secretive but energetic, hopping and fluttering from branch to branch through tangles of vegetation.
